Overview
- Airport monitoring detected an unauthorized person at 08:15 on runway 29R near a Volaris jet scheduled for Acapulco.
- Security teams activated the local airport security plan, SENEAM paused arrivals and departures, AFAC was notified, and fire-rescue units were deployed.
- Guardia Nacional personnel detained the individual on the field and transferred him to the Ministerio Público to begin legal proceedings.
- The aircraft operating Volaris flight 1332 was inspected, found undamaged, and cleared, and the runway was reopened after safety checks.
- The disruption delayed seven flights, operations have returned to normal, and GAP says it will implement additional security measures after its investigation.
